Driving in Vietnam as a France National

Vietnam drives on the right with motorbike-dominated traffic, chaotic urban streets, and growing highway infrastructure. Foreigners face restrictions on car driving; an IDP is required.

Speed Limits in Vietnam

Urban
40-60 km/h
Rural / Open road
60-80 km/h
Highway / Motorway
80-120 km/h

Documents to Carry in Vietnam

  • Original driving licence from France — must be valid and unexpired
  • International Driving Permit (IDP) — required in Vietnam. Obtain from your national motoring association before travelling.
  • Passport or national ID — carry at all times while driving
  • Car insurance certificate — verify it covers Vietnam before departure
  • Vehicle registration / rental agreement
